我正在开发一款iPhone应用程序,在某个时刻,它会尝试发送电子邮件。如果用户设置了电子邮件,那么很好,如果没有,我需要相应地更改一些操作。我的问题是如何检查用户的iPhone是否设置了电子邮件帐户?我到处都看,但似乎无法找到答案。
我正在使用MFMailViewController发送消息,但我不想创建它的实例,除非我可以实际发送一些东西。有什么想法吗?
答案 0 :(得分:4)
MFMailComposeViewController类具有+canSendMail
方法
返回一个布尔值,指示是否 当前设备能够发送 电子邮件。 (如果设备配置为发送电子邮件,则为“是”;否则为“否”。)